Supplemental Regulations for June 18th, 2014 ASCC Club autoslalom #3

Location: Scotia Speed World, near Halifax International Airport, Halifax NS

Organizer: ASCC Solo Committee.
Course Set Up Workforce: ***Volunteers Needed
Timing and Scoring: James,Charlotte Cathy Partridge, and Krista Barron
Registrar: Krista Barron, Charlotte and Carthy Partridge.
Chief Scrutineer: TBD
Safety Steward: TBD
Entry Fee: $20.00 (for members of an ARMS-affiliate club).

Schedule:

1600: Gates open. Volunteers are asked to arrive.
1630: Registration and Scrutineering Open.
1730: Registration and Scrutineering Closed.
1735: Drivers meeting.
1740: "Official" course walk/drive.
1800: First car starts.

In order for this to run efficiently, we need to follow this schedule precisely.

Registration will be closed at 1730 on the dot.

Insurance: As required by ARMS, provided by ASN Canada FIA. Waiver to be signed by all persons on-site.

Regulations: This event will be held under the General Competition Rules of ARMS, and the Atlantic Sports Car Club event regulations. This is the 3rd event of the 2014 ASCC club Autoslalom season.

Absolutely no speeding or reckless driving around the site will be tolerated. Driving behavior during the event will be discussed at the drivers meeting

Notes:

The ASCC has SSW rented from 1600-2000. Therefore the schedule as shown above will be STRICTLY enforced.
If we do not have time for every car to run 4 runs, your time will be scored on your first 3 runs.

Run/Work Groups:

All cars must have their competition number and class displayed on both sides of their car for the benefit of the Paddock Marshall and the Timing and Scoring staff.

There will be 1 run group. After your run you have 4-5Min to check your car and times, then relieve the person next to run at the station start informed you to go to. Competitors are reminded to report quickly to their workstations in order to ensure quick turn around. Failure to report for work assignment will result in forfeiture of points and any remaining runs.
